Transaction 51f8882edab13216509a5476b0ad78fe2c4ffbb201d45a5533b0ca972d27f5c9
1 Input
1 Output
-
51f8882edab13216509a5476b0ad78fe2c4ffbb201d45a5533b0ca972d27f5c9:0
- value
- 131669
- script pubkey
- OP_0 OP_PUSHBYTES_20 4d156bcb56645e2299f628b29b76ef210eb953e5
- address
- bc1qf52khj6kv30z9x0k9zefkah0yy8tj5l9wmrl44